Introduction

Health and safety (H&S) management is a science and management discipline in its own right and there have been many books written on the topic; therefore, this chapter focuses on operational health and safety and is deliberately “light-touch” but worthy of inclusion, some smaller businesses have little or no health and safety contingent and the content herein may prove helpful.
